Course Details

• Railway Infrastructure Engineering
• Transportation Systems Analysis
• Railway Track Design and Construction
• Rail Operations and Management
• Railway Planning and Project Evaluation
• Rail Transportation Economics
• Environmental and Social Impact Assessment for Rail
• Railway Safety and Security Planning
• Geographic Information Systems (GIS) for Railway Infrastructure
